阿里云ECS(弹性计算服务)不支持直接更改实例的地域。一旦ECS实例创建完成,其所在的地域(Region)是固定的,无法通过控制台或API直接迁移或修改。
但你可以通过以下方式实现“更换地域”的效果:
✅ 解决方案:跨地域迁移ECS实例
方法一:使用 镜像(Image) 迁移(推荐)
-
在原地域创建自定义镜像
- 登录 阿里云ECS控制台。
- 找到目标ECS实例 → 更多 → 实例设置 → 创建自定义镜像。
- 等待镜像创建完成(包含系统盘和数据盘,如需可添加数据盘快照)。
-
复制镜像到目标地域
- 在“镜像”页面 → 选择刚创建的自定义镜像 → 操作列点击“复制镜像”。
- 选择目标地域(Destination Region),然后确认复制。
- 等待复制完成(可能需要几分钟)。
-
在目标地域使用镜像创建新ECS实例
- 切换到目标地域。
- 使用复制过去的自定义镜像创建新的ECS实例。
- 配置相同的实例规格、安全组、VPC网络等。
-
迁移公网IP或绑定新EIP
- 原EIP不能跨地域迁移,需在新地域重新申请EIP并绑定。
- 如有域名,更新DNS解析指向新实例的公网IP。
-
验证并释放旧实例
- 测试新实例是否正常运行。
- 确认无误后,在原地域释放旧ECS实例以节省费用。
方法二:手动备份与重建(适用于简单环境)
- 手动将应用、配置文件、数据库等备份下来。
- 在目标地域新建ECS实例,重新部署环境。
- 适合小型项目或可以接受手动操作的场景。
⚠️ 注意事项
- 镜像复制会产生费用(存储 + 跨地域复制流量费)。
- 跨地域复制镜像时间取决于镜像大小,建议在网络空闲时段操作。
- 数据盘需单独创建快照并包含在镜像中,或单独复制。
- VPC网络、安全组、SLB、RDS等资源也需在目标地域重新配置或迁移。
- 公网IP不能保留,需使用域名解耦IP依赖。
📌 总结
❌ 不能直接更改ECS地域
✅ 可通过「创建自定义镜像 → 复制镜像到目标地域 → 新建实例」实现迁移
如需自动化或大规模迁移,可考虑使用阿里云的 服务器迁移中心(SMC) 工具,支持本地或其他云主机迁移到阿里云指定地域。
🔗 参考文档:
- 阿里云镜像复制
- 服务器迁移中心 SMC
如有具体需求(如带宽、数据量大等),也可联系阿里云技术支持协助迁移。
云服务器